DIETARY SODIUM CHLORIDE Meaning and Definition

  1. Dietary Sodium Chloride is a chemical compound that consists of two essential elements, sodium (Na) and chloride (Cl), and is commonly known as salt. It is a crystalline, white, and odorless substance that is widely used as a flavor enhancer and preservative in food preparation.

    The term "dietary" refers to the intake of substances through the diet or food we consume. Sodium chloride is an essential dietary mineral required for various physiological functions in the human body. It plays a vital role in maintaining fluid balance, nerve impulse transmission, and muscle contraction.

    However, excessive consumption of dietary sodium chloride can lead to negative health effects. High levels of sodium chloride intake have been associated with increased risk of developing hypertension, cardiovascular diseases, and kidney problems. Therefore, it is crucial to monitor and control the intake of dietary sodium chloride.

    The recommended daily intake of dietary sodium chloride varies among individuals based on their age, health conditions, and physical activities. Many health organizations and dietary guidelines suggest limiting the intake of added salt during food preparation and being cautious of processed food products that tend to have higher sodium chloride content.

    Overall, dietary sodium chloride is a vital component in human nutrition, but its consumption should be moderated to maintain a healthy lifestyle and prevent adverse health effects.
